Holy moly. My heart is still melted and my soul still filled with sun and light and energy and all things good from last night’s Holland show with Anathallo, Caspia, and Ashton. Ashton got everyone in the mood by cranking it out with sounds that rolled through the Holland space like thunder–rock thunder that is. As midwesters Anathallo began to set up their intricate set (lots of drums, horns, various strings, xylophones, bells, keyboard, guitars, mics galore..), we braced ourselves for something truly terrific–and believe me, we got way more. The 7 or 8 piece band (nine? ten? definitely seemed like a small melodic army of sort, armed with almost every instrument known to man), blew our socks off and had the entire audience holding their breath in disbelief. Simply beautiful, but also a ton of fun. And we at Holland are determined to have them back soon–and when we do, you’ll want to be there with your entire posse in tow. They were that good. LA’s Caspia finshed the night by paying respect to Reno’s own Project Moonshine and playing some of the finely crafted original tracks they created especially for the Moonshine film, Being Here. As the lights dimmed and Moonshine and other footage played in the background, Caspia’s hyponotic electro beats swept us away to a dreamy place. Some photos below, but check out Flickr HERE .
